Since the beginning of the partnership in 2014, CEIM has supported more than a dozen McGill Start-ups spanning a range of disciplines:
Acoustics, Medical diagnostics, Environmental site remediation, Green construction materials, Pharmaceuticals, MRI scanning technology, Climate forecasting, Neurology, and more.


TESTIMONIAL: ANOMERA

In 2016, Prof. Andrews from the Faculty of Science and his team spun out their company, Anomera, to convert renewable forest resources into game-changing cellulose based ingredients for cosmetics.
